Abstract

The present invention relates to a method for clustering emergency calls and a system to perform the method. With the present invention, the resource utilization of a PSAP center can significantly be improved, and at the same time, the response time of all calls that reach the PSAP center is reduced. This is achieved by providing a mechanism that allows clustering of calls, and an advanced handling of a majority of them. A personalized message is used to communicate an ongoing major incident to callers to pre-handle a burst of calls. Therefore, the call agent only has to take calls that have not already been successfully handled by the personalized messages.

Claims (33)

1 . A method for clustering emergency calls, the method comprising the steps of:

S 210 receiving, by a Public Safety Answering Point, PSAP, a new emergency event from an Emergency Service Routing Proxy, ESRP;

S 220 extracting, by an application, key data regarding the new emergency event;

S 230 preparing, by the application, a search key for clustering incoming calls belonging to the same event, based on the key data extracted in the previous step;

S 235 checking, by the application, whether a matching event is in a cluster storage, based on the extracted key data of the incoming event and key data of previously reported events in the cluster storage;

S 240 adding, by the application, further key data into the cluster storage, in case a matching event is in the cluster storage;

S 250 sending, by the application, a personalized message to the emergency caller, using the available key data of the matching event in the cluster storage; and

S 500 ending the method.

2 . The method according to claim 1 , wherein in case no matching event is in the cluster storage, the method further comprises:

S 260 optimizing, by the application, the search key, in case no matching event is in the cluster storage;

S 270 adding, by the application, an abandoned event to the abandoned events without clustering, in case the optimization is not successful; and

S 500 ending the method.

3 . The method according to claim 2 , wherein in case the optimization of the search key is not successful, the method further comprises:

S 280 creating, by the application, a new entry of an incoming event into the cluster based on the previously prepared search key;

S 290 moving, by the application, the incoming event to the call handling system;

S 300 monitoring, by the application, a Real-Time-Protocol, RTP, streaming, and extracting, by the application, event key words;

S 310 updating, by the application, the entry into the cluster storage with the event key words; and

S 500 ending the method.

4 . The method according to claim 2 , wherein in case the optimization of the search key is successful, the method further comprises:

S 240 adding, by the application, further key data into the cluster storage, in case a matching event is in the cluster storage;

S 250 sending, by the application, a personalized message to the emergency caller, using the available key data of the matching event in the cluster storage;

S 500 ending the method; or

S 260 optimizing, by the application, the search key, in case no matching event is in the cluster storage.

5 . The method according to claim 2 , wherein optimizing represents a tree diagram of the emergency data and their connection, wherein the search key starts from a corresponding optimization level based on the key data extracted from a new emergency call.

6 . The method according to claim 1 , wherein the application is an entity of the emergency system, a part of the the Public Safety Answering Point, PSAP, and/or designed as a bot and/or as an Interactive Voice Responder, IVR, and/or the application can be running as an external component where the PSAP has access.

7 . The method according to claim 1 , wherein the key data are selected from the group comprising time, location locX and other parameters like ADR Y and ADR Z.

8 . The method according to claim 7 , wherein the parameters ADR Y and ADR Z are selected from Uniform Resource Name, URN, service SOS sub-service, an emergency call data service info-element, or an emergency call data comment-element.

9 . The method according to claim 1 , wherein the clustering is based on a location locX within a time-window t.

10 . The method according to claim 1 , wherein the key data are stored at corresponding optimization levels, preferably wherein there are up to three optimization levels.

11 . A system for clustering emergency calls, wherein the system is configured to perform the method according to claim 1 .

12 . The system according to claim 11 , wherein the system comprises an Emergency Service Routing Proxy, ESRP, an application, a Public Safety Answering Point, PSAP and a cluster storage.

13 . The system according to claim 12 , wherein the application is an entity of the emergency system, a part of the Public Safety Answering Point, PSAP, or another component of the network system, and/or designed as a bot and/or as an Interactive Voice Responder, IVR and/or the application can be running as an external component where the PSAP has access.

14 . The system according to claim 12 , wherein the cluster storage contains the key data information in a node-tree architecture.
